SDL Acquires Xopus

SDL announced the acquisition of Xopus, a provider of online XML editing. The acquisition by SDL’s Structured Content Technologies division addresses the growing trend to broaden the adoption of structured authoring beyond technical writers. Founded in 2001 in the Netherlands, Xopus has emerged as a friendly and simple-to-use online XML editor. Complementing high-end XML editors that are designed specifically for technical writers, Xopus enables a broader audience to contribute comments and content to increasingly distributed structured authoring processes. Accessed through a Web browser, Xopus provides the flexibility, ease-of-use, and interactivity of a Wiki, while still leveraging the benefits of structured content. The Xopus organization will become part of SDL’s Structured Content Technologies division. A prototype integration already exists between SDL Xopus and SDL Trisoft, the company’s Component Content Management system for DITA. Looking forward, SDL Xopus will be integrated with SDL LiveContent , the company’s publishing solution. Future integrations are envisioned with SDL Contenta  for S1000D and related markets, as well as SDL’s suite of Global Information Management technologies. SDL will continue its philosophy of supporting an “open technology” approach to the enterprise ecosystem through integration to 3rd party applications and systems. SDL Xopus will continue to support existing integrations to 3rd party content management systems. http://www.sdl.com/ 

Nuxeo, the Open Source Enterprise Content Management (ECM) company, announced Nuxeo Case Management Framework (Nuxeo CMF) package for application builders, ISVs and information architects that need to deliver content-centric applications to business users. The open source case management framework is delivered as a downloadable product complete with templates, samples and documentation to ease deployments of content applications based on the Nuxeo Enterprise Platform (Nuxeo EP). Nuxeo Case Management Framework adds functionality to support the flow of related content items that need to be handled, managed and analyzed in a case-centric metaphor. Nuxeo CMF is unique for a case management framework from an ECM provider in that it has been released as open source. Nuxeo is deeply committed to both open source and open standards - ensuring full compliance with key initiatives such as CMIS (Content Management Interoperability Services), Dublin Core, PDF/A, OpenSocial and OSGi. The Nuxeo Case Management framework is a full-featured, extensible toolkit that natively includes document management, collaboration, workflow, reporting, dashboards and unified in-box management functionality. This allows application builders to focus on building templates, plug-ins and business logic to meet specific content management requirements determined by industry-specific use cases or externally-imposed regulatory mandates. Nuxeo Case Management Framework Feature Highlights include: Creation of cases with attachments, metadata, and a managed workflow path; Edit and update case and case item metadata, status, attachments, relationships; Centralized routing service to distribute and route cases manually or based on business rules, including pre-defined and customizable distribution lists, "cc:" notifications; Creation of unified mailboxes to capture incoming communication and content types from diverse sources; Classification and categorization of cases and case items; Configuration of complex business logic with Nuxeo EP's content automation; Filing and browsing of cases with file plans, with a metadata axis (faceted browsing) and social tagging; Comprehensive search including fulltext; Reporting capabilities; Content life cycle management, notifications and email alerts; Content markup and annotations; Security based on dynamic access control and complex users, groups and permission services including delegation of decision-making; Customizable and centralized audit trail; Workflow for document, task and process management; Standardized interfaces for item intake from capture systems; Open Java and Web Services (REST) APIs; CMIS compliant by leveraging the power of the underlying Nuxeo Enterprise Platform; Modular, extensible ECM components and services for application development; and Integration across the IT ecosystem. http://www.nuxeo.com/

Brainshark, Inc., a provider of on-demand multimedia for business, announced Brainshark Mobile, enabling smartphone and iPad users to view Brainshark-delivered communications on their mobile devices. Now, Brainshark's enterprise customers, as well as users of the free myBrainshark.com site, can create content that can be viewed anywhere, anytime and on most devices. Brainshark presentations combine voice narration, PowerPoint slides, video and more for a multimedia experience. The presentations play as streamed video files when viewed on mobile devices. Through Brainshark's analytics capabilities, users can see when their presentations were viewed, who viewed them, if content was viewed on a mobile device and what type of device was used. Platforms and devices supported by Brainshark Mobile include the BlackBerry, Palm Pre, iPhone, iPod touch, iPad and Android; all must support streaming video. For Brainshark's enterprise users, Brainshark Mobile is included at no additional cost as part of Brainshark's core platform. Presentations created are automatically mobile-enabled. http://presentation.brainshark.com/

Google has announced a set of new features and editors available to Google Docs users. Google Docs will now have new editors for documents and spreadsheets, designed to be faster and support more features. Documents will now feature character-by-character real-time collaboration, a ruler for custom margins and tab stops, as well as improvements to the import function. The new version of spreadsheets has been enhanced for speed, includes a formula editing bar, cell auto-complete and more. Google Docs accounts through universities, employers or organizations will start seeing the new editors by default in the coming weeks. You can now set a document, spreadsheet, presentation or drawing to be “Private,” available to “Anyone with the link,” or “Public on the web,” and then customize who has access by inviting specific collaborators. If you’re using Google Docs at work or at school, you’ll also see options to share your files just with other people within your organization. New features for the drawings editor in Google Docs were implented as well. Now you can center objects on the page, resize the entire canvas, view thumbnails of your drawings in your doc list, search across your drawings by text contained within and view a list of editing keyboard shortcuts. We also added the ability for you to share drawings in the Google Docs template gallery, so other people around the world can use your creations. http://www.google.com/

Saba has announced the Saba Collaboration Suite, a real-time collaboration and enterprise business networking solution designed to enable social learning and collaborative performance management. Saba Collaboration Suite infuses real-time collaboration and enterprise business networking capabilities into learning and performance management people processes. Saba Collaboration Suite combines Saba Live, an enterprise business networking offering, and Saba Centra, an enterprise web conferencing solution. Saba Live will integrate Saba's person profile, and will include embedded competency-driven expertise, Twitter-like performance feedback, blended learning, and workplace analytics. Features include real-time communication capabilities such as instant messaging, video-enabled channels, VoIP-enabled online meetings, and web conferences. Saba Dynamic Network Analysis (DNA), is a workplace analytics platform for visualizing connections between people and resources to provide strategic organizational insight. www.saba.com

Cisco announced new and enhanced collaboration solutions designed to help workers to connect to the right people and access and share content remotely. Cisco announced that Cisco Quad, an enterprise collaboration platform will be available later this year via native iPad and iPhone applications. Cisco also unveiled a new Cisco Prosumer Video solution which integrates Cisco FocalPoint, an online video workspace with a business-class Cisco Flip MinoPRO camcorder. Finally, Cisco announced that Cisco WebEx Connect IM is now available across browsers. Together, these three collaboration solutions offer a secure, manageable collaborative environment with video, real time instant messaging (IM) and social networking capabilities. Cisco Quad highlights include: the ability to search across content within the organization, as well as locate people and expertise; Mobile Quad applications optimized for the Apple iPad and iPhone; Integratation with content management systems such as Microsoft SharePoint and Documentum, as well as with voice and video business communications solutions; and every Quad user will receive a Cisco Show and Share license granting video authoring, posting, publishing and editing capabilities. Quad will be available on a limited basis, beginning in Cisco's first quarter of fiscal year 2011, in the United States, Canada, the United Kingdom, and Australia/New Zealand. The Cisco Prosumer Video solution highlights include a new online video workspace, FocalPoint, and a new business-class four-hour Flip MinoPRO camcorder. FocalPoint delivers cloud-based management, sharing and editing capabilities and provides an easy way for organizational teams to interact with their video content. Cisco FlipShare software, preloaded on the camcorder, allows users to edit, store and manage video content locally on their workstation before sharing it with the organizational team via FocalPoint. The software client uses an encrypted upload protocol to enable confidential content delivery, while FocalPoint adopts SSL (Secure Socket Layer) for highly secure Web sessions and data protection. The Cisco Prosumer Video solution is part of the Cisco collaboration portfolio and will be available through Cisco channel partners beginning in August. The newest version of Cisco WebEx Connect IM lets users access their contact lists and send instant messages via a browser-based IM client, making the solution accessible from any computer without the need for a client download. The Windows client for Cisco WebEx Connect IM is now localized for French, German, Spanish, Italian and Japanese. Server-side IM logging allows organizations to capture logs of all IM traffic for efficient regulatory compliance. Customers who are already archiving email can use their existing infrastructure. Building on Cisco's acquisition of Jabber, customers looking to add presence and chat capabilities to their Web applications can do so with Cisco's AJAX XMPP library, for developing Web applications and portal integrations. These tools were used in building presence and chat capabilities into Cisco Quad. http://www.cisco.com/

Open Text Corporation has announced an expanded family of social media offerings aimed at enabling businesses to apply social media to solve business challenges.  Open Text aims to help drive productivity within the enterprise with social media solutions that let users create profiles, follow co-workers and generate news feeds, or collaborate on projects.  With the new and enhanced capabilities, attention was paid to ease of use for business users and application to real challenges, along with continued full support for Open Text’s core competence in information governance and control.  Offerings now include: Open Text Social Communities – Formerly Vignette Community Applications and Services, Open Text Social Communities is an enterprise social media solution for engaging with customers, employees, and partners. As part of a broader marketing and CRM strategy, social media can give companies greater market insight, improved market engagement and, more importantly, significant improvements in customer satisfaction and retention. Enhancements in the latest release support rapid creation of socially enabled websites along with social microsites that combine Web 2.0 functionality, with analytics and social search. Now part of Open Text ECM Suite, Open Text Social Communities consolidates social applications, such as video galleries, photo galleries, slideshows, comments, ratings, forums, blogs, wikis, download management, event management, and idea management with user profiles, microblogging, social bookmarking, and group and moderation support. http://www.opentext.com
